IELTS Free Online Writing Practice - The importance of opensource software in promoting innovation.
IELTS.WORK Free Online Writing Practice # 1713396371
Topic: The importance of open-source software in promoting innovation.
Question: In what ways can open-source software contribute to the growth and development of innovation? Discuss the advantages and disadvantages of using open-source software, and provide specific examples to support your ideas.
Model Answer:
Open-source software has become an increasingly significant factor in promoting innovation in various industries worldwide. This essay will discuss the ways in which it contributes to growth and development, as well as examining the advantages and disadvantages of using open-source software.
One of the primary benefits of open-source software is that it allows for greater collaboration among developers from around the world. By making source code available to anyone, developers can contribute their expertise and skills to improve upon existing projects or create entirely new ones. This collaborative approach not only accelerates the development process but also results in more innovative solutions due to a diverse range of perspectives and ideas being incorporated into the software. For example, the creation of the Linux operating system is a testament to the power of open-source collaboration, as it has become one of the most widely used and respected operating systems today.
Another advantage of open-source software is that it promotes transparency and accountability in the development process. Since the source code is available for public review, users can identify potential issues or vulnerabilities within the software, which can then be addressed by developers more efficiently. This level of scrutiny not only improves the overall quality of the software but also helps to prevent security breaches and other technical problems from going unnoticed.
However, there are some disadvantages to using open-source software as well. One concern is that the lack of a centralized authority overseeing development projects may lead to inconsistencies in code quality or functionality. Additionally, open-source software often requires users to have advanced technical skills in order to install, customize, and troubleshoot the software effectively. This can create barriers for those without such expertise, potentially limiting the number of people who can benefit from using open-source solutions.
In conclusion, while there are certainly challenges associated with using open-source software, its capacity to promote innovation and collaboration among developers should not be underestimated. The growth and development of numerous innovative projects have been significantly impacted by the use of open-source software, showcasing its potential as a powerful tool for fostering innovation in various industries worldwide.
Score:
Band 8.5
Source:
https://www.ielts.work/?id=1713396371&page=ielts-writing-practice

For more:
https://www.ielts.work/?page=ielts-writing-practice
